Section C – Details of Search

Complete the Details of Search section by doing the following:
  • Select at least one box of the following: Surface, Minerals, Titles, and/or Instruments.

Please enter a Legal Land Description and include any additional information for the search results you are requesting.
  • For example - Enter the ¼ section, township , range, meridian and additional information such as „north of the railway‟or „include all parcels within the land description.‟

Select one of the Search to options. This enables ISC to determine whether you want the historical information from the Grant, when a specific person owned the land, or discover who owned the land at a specific date.
  • For example, Search to: Name - John Doe will return a search when John Doe was the owner of the Land.

Select how you would like your search results returned: e-mail, fax or mail. Please note that you may select more than one method of delivery, however, additional fees will apply.

Please be advised that the fee for a Historical Search includes the hourly rate for the Historic Search plus all applicable search and output fees.  For the current fee schedule visit www.isc.ca/fees.

You will be contacted if additional funds are required in order to complete the search you have requested.

To be sure that you have sufficient funds available at the time of processing, you may enter in a "maximum amount" to be charged to your account. For example, you may wish to enter a maximum amount of $300.00, if the transaction is greater than the $300.00 then ISC will contact you for additional funds. If it is less than $300.00, your account will only be charged for the cost to perform the search.
